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on protecting the area beneath a building from moisture intrusion and water damage. This process typically involves installing a combination of drainage systems, vapor barriers, and sealing techniques to prevent water from seeping into the crawlspace.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ment that not only safeguards the structural integrity of the property but also helps improve indoor air quality by reducing mold and mildew growth caused by excess moisture.

Many common problems prompt property owners to seek crawlspace waterproofing. Excess moisture can lead to wood rot, foundation issues, and increased pest activity. Additionally, damp crawlspaces often contribute to higher energy bills due to increased humidity and temperature fluctuations within the home. Waterproofing services address these issues by managing water flow and moisture levels, helping to prevent costly repairs and maintain a healthier living environment.

Properties that frequently benefit from crawlspace waterproofing include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Older homes with aging foundations are also common candidates, as their crawlspaces may be more vulnerable to water infiltration. Commercial buildings, particularly those with basements or lower levels that serve as crawlspaces, can also see improvements in durability and safety through professional waterproofing solutions.

What are common signs that a crawlspace needs waterproofing? Indicators include persistent dampness, mold growth, musty odors, and visible water intrusion or pooling inside the crawlspace.

How can waterproofing improve a home's indoor air quality? Waterproofing helps prevent mold and mildew growth, which can contribute to healthier indoor air by reducing airborne allergens and pollutants.

What waterproofing methods do local contractors typically use for crawlspaces? Contractors often use interior sealants, vapor barriers, exterior drainage systems, and sump pumps to protect crawlspaces from moisture intrusion.

Is crawlspace waterproofing a suitable solution for homes in areas with heavy rainfall? Yes, waterproofing can help manage excess moisture and prevent water intrusion in regions prone to heavy rainfall or flooding.

How often should crawlspace waterproofing systems be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ended annually or after severe weather events to ensure systems remain effective and in good condition.
